I have never ran my 90 coupe at the strip but was wondering my car has been weighed and on the dyno...car weighs 2760 and put down 330 horsepower to the rear wheels my question is would it be feasible to run 12's with that..car hooks good been lightened up a lot with also has nitto drags 3.73 gears with t5z trans...didn't really know where to post this so here goes...and if you feel the need to flame me go ahead and if you don't thanks for the info in advance..
